The Burdekin region extends from the town of Ravenswood at the top of the Great Dividing Range in the west and east to the coast. It includes part of the Great Barrier Reef and the small coastal communities of Wunjunga in the south to Giru in the north. There is a thriving horticulture industry in the Burdekin, with abundant harvests of mango, rockmelon, honeydew, tomatoes, eggplant and capsicum as well as sorghum, corn and pasture grasses. The area is one of Australia's largest producers of sugarcane (more than 8 million tonnes each year) and also hosts a prospering aquaculture industry that supplies not only the local region, but international markets as well. The main campus is made up of an administration building, student residential accommodation, classrooms, workshops, staff housing, a 400-hectare sugar farm, a 125-hectare small crops section and over 2000 hectares of general grazing country.
